# Sensor drift compensation for the Fernvale greenhouse controller.
# Welcome aboard — read this before editing anything. The humidity
# and CO2 probes drift measurably between calibration cycles, so
# this module applies a rolling correction based on the reference
# sensor in bay three. If corrections exceed the clamp threshold,
# we flag the probe for recalibration rather than silently adjusting.
# Change these values only with a calibration log to justify it.
# The tuning constants are defined below.

limits module of tafop-hahop:
WEIGHTS = {
    "julmir": 223,
    "belox": 987,
    "lamion": 470,
    "pelath": 609,
    "fraok": 1010,
    "eliion": 343,
    "drudor": 342,
}

Ticket #—Shuttle-bus gate, Fernhollow Campus. Hey team, the gate arm at the south shuttle stop keeps sticking halfway, so drivers are getting backed up during the morning run. Facilities says a tech from Larkspell Controls will swing by Wednesday, but until then the gate's on manual override. Assistants escorting guests to the shuttle should wave the driver through and log the trip in the binder at reception. If you need to open the gate yourself, punch in the override code below.

badge for bawif-yawig: bdg-XQF-7

Ticket: Staging env misconfigured for Siftgate bloom filter

The bloom layer in front of the Pellet KV store is rejecting all lookups in staging because the env file was copied from the dev template without credentials. False-positive tuning values are fine; only the auth line is missing. To unblock the weekly demo, the Pellet admission secret must be set on the following line.

env line for yaguf-fajop: LEDGER_TOKEN13=fb08984397349

**CI note: waveform preview job failing on Pindlecast main**

The audio waveform preview step in the Pindlecast pipeline fails intermittently when the render container starts before the sample fixtures finish syncing. Symptom: blank PNG artifacts and a nonzero exit from the preview script. Re-running the stage usually clears it; the real fix is adding a readiness check before render. If it recurs tonight, capture the trace token printed below.

pipeline stamp: htk6_35e0c9